At 11:23am on March 1, 2008, Arseny SergeyevArseny Sergeyev said…
it mean from one side -- "it's pity to destroy the prints & DVD's" after exhibition", from other side we never will use them after exhibition without authors permition (no sells, no exhibits, no commercial publications for exhample in wall calendars or so, etc, except promotional publicity - articles devoted exhibition), but we plan pay for such using in future, if for example, if airport administration wll want to use works from exhibition in commercial fairs of aeroindustry for example. From third side works will exhibited at least 3 month in not museum or gallery conditions, I'm not sure that they will in perfect commercial condition after that. from fourth side all works exhibited are just digital copies of authors works, without signature & fixing ammount of editions they are haven't true commercial value, as you understand organizing such procedure imposible (too expencieve in russian situation), from fifth side organizers cover all production costs, exhibition & security expences, publicity & catalogue print.
Artists get free copy of catalogue & publicity (really every day about 2000 passengers only pass thru airport, except people who come to meet them)
If you want that your work must be destroyed after exhibition -- no problem. I promise it will done, anyway all copyright issues are on conscience of organizers.
Hope I answer your questions.
At 9:15am on March 1, 2008, Amina BechAmina Bech said…
I just wonder about this; "work will be stored in the public art collection of Koltsovo Airport after the end of the exhibition"..
Does this means that the airport "owns" my work after the exhibit?
so what the artists get is publicity?
